Position Title:
Robotics Control Engineer
PositionDescription:
Protingent Staffing has an exciting Direct Hire Robotics Control Engineer opportunity located in Lynchburg, VA.
Job Responsibilities:- Performs a variety of more complex non-standard engineering and new-to-you assignments typically in areas of design, development, analysis, evaluation, testing, preparation of specifications, execution of field tasks and resolution of field problems, and resolution of quality events.
- Performs independent review of department work products, risk assessments, Apparent Cause Analyses, Failure Modes and Effects Analysis etc.
- Proposes solutions and work scope to Supervisor, works autonomously on most assignments and solutions.
- Ensures compliance with government regulations, organization, industry and customer engineering standards.
- Independently evaluates, selects and applies a variety of technical techniques, procedures, and criteria using judgement in making more complex adaptations and modifications for tasks not previously performed.
- Develops new or adapted products, methods, systems or models to provide added value solutions to customers.
- Understands impact of work on other organizations internally and externally.
- Works on special projects, as directed.
- Provides suggestions for improving processes and implementing process improvements.
- Actively participates in technical communications with internal customers.
- Bachelor’s Degree in Electrical Engineering.
- Dependent on the position, degrees in Physics, Engineering Technology and Engineering Science may also be accepted.
- Minimum of 5 years of related experience.
- Advanced knowledge of related engineering standards, techniques and criteria.
- Good communication skills to comprehend and convey detailed technical data.
- Ability to develop and maintain good interpersonal relationships; work collaboratively within a team environment.
- Advanced problem identification and problem resolution skills.
- Displays leadership characteristics.
- Exhibits questioning attitude and practices self-checking.
- Advanced level of specific software tools (FPGA/VHDL ) and programming skills.
- Experience in control system design, including both analog and digital controls.
- Experienced in troubleshooting hardware issues from system level to board level to component level.
- Motion control experience.
